Influencers or Innovators? The Role of Social Media in Defining Careers

Social media has emerged as a powerful platform that not only connects people but also shapes careers. Today, the digital landscape is filled with influencers and innovators who are leveraging social media to build their personal brands and professional networks. But what roles do these individuals play in defining careers? And how does social media contribute to this process?

Influencers are individuals who have gained a significant following on social media platforms due to their expertise or charisma. They leverage their online presence to impact their followers’ purchasing decisions by promoting products, services, or ideas. Their role in defining careers lies in the fact that they represent new-age professions that didn’t exist a couple of decades ago. Aspiring influencers look up to them for inspiration and guidance on building successful careers.

On the other hand, innovators use social media differently. These are individuals who introduce new ideas or methods within their respective industries – be it technology, education, healthcare etc., often disrupting traditional norms and practices along the way. Innovators utilize social media platforms as channels for showcasing their groundbreaking work and connecting with like-minded professionals globally.

The role of innovators in shaping careers is profound too; they inspire others by demonstrating how creativity and originality can lead to breakthroughs in various fields of work. Moreover, they provide valuable insights into emerging trends and technologies which can help aspirants stay ahead of the curve.

Social media plays a crucial role in defining these two career paths by providing an accessible platform for both influencers and innovators alike to showcase their skills or contributions while reaching out to a global audience instantly.

For influencers, it provides tools necessary for content creation – photography apps for perfect shots; video editing software for creating engaging vlogs; analytics tools for understanding audience preferences etc., all aimed at helping them create impactful content consistently.

For innovators too – whether they’re sharing thought leadership articles on LinkedIn, showcasing their latest inventions on Instagram, or hosting webinars and live Q&A sessions on Facebook – social media serves as an indispensable tool for sharing knowledge and fostering collaborations.

In conclusion, whether one chooses to be an influencer or innovator, it’s clear that social media is a game-changer in defining careers. It has opened up new avenues of work that were previously unimaginable. While both influencers and innovators play different roles, they share the common thread of utilizing social media to its fullest potential in carving out successful careers for themselves while inspiring others along the way.
